青海省东昆仑洪水河东地区斑岩铜钼矿找矿潜力分析

摘要: 洪水河东地区岩浆活动强烈,石英闪长斑岩、英云闪长斑岩较发育,岩体、围岩及其接触带绿泥石化、绿帘石化、碳酸盐化、钾长石化、高岭土化、迪开石化、绢云母化和矽卡岩化等蚀变普遍且较强烈,具斑岩型矿化蚀变特征。研究区内Cu、Mo、W化探组合异常分布较多,具备典型的斑岩铜矿床的元素组合特征,岩体含矿性与化探异常吻合,且在研究区盘羊沟、乌腊德地区发现了铜钼矿体。据此分析,认为洪水河东地区具备斑岩铜钼矿成矿地质条件,斑岩型铜钼矿找矿潜力较大。

Abstract: In the east of Hongshui River,there was an intense magmatic activity and it develops into a series of quartzdiorite porphyrite and tonaliteporphyrite.The alteration characteristics of porphyry mineralized,such as chloritization,epidotization,carbonatization,potash feldspathization,kaolinization,dicanization,sericitization and skarnization,are commonly developed in the intrusion,wallrock and their contact zone.In this area,there are broad Cu,Mo,W geochemical composite anomalies,which are the typical elements assemblage of porphyry copper deposits.Moreover,the ore-bearing bodies are able to correlate the geochemical anomalies and we have found the Panyanggou and Wulade Cu-Mo ore bodies.So,eastern of Hongshui River has the ore-forming geological conditions of Porphyry Cu-Mo Deposit and there is a big potential for porphyry copper-molybdenum.-
